Los Tacos is a mexican restaurant located in Douglasville, Georgia. It is an authentically Mexican taco restaurant that offers a diverse range of culinary choices. They offer a variety of protein, rice, and bean options for their tacos, burritos, nachos, and enchiladas. They also feature both authentic and Americanized versions of Mexican cuisine. Customers can enjoy traditional Mexican favorites such as street tacos, churros, and horchata, and can also choose from specialty fusion dishes that often feature Tex-Mex and American flavors to create unique and flavorful dishes.

If you haven't been here, just go. Order the barbacoa (birria?) Tacos and you will have 0 regrets. They are flavorful, cheesy, fried, greasy, messy and you can add what you want. I tried it plain, loaded with cilantro and onion, then with the cilantro, onions, jalapeno sauce and dipped in the broth sauce that comes with the tacos. I ate all 3 tacos y'all. I regretted it because I was so full but would do it all over again. My grandma got the wet burrito and it was HUGE. Usually she can clear a plate, but not this time. We will definitely be back. They weren't very busy even though it was lunch time so there wasn't a wait. The employees were very nice and answered any questions we have. The prices were competitive for the quality and serving size of the plates.
Needed some food before a long ride home to Birmingham, AL. I wish we had stopped anywhere else. I ordered the chicken mini tacos. I was asked if I wanted shredded chicken or grilled chicken. I went with grilled. What I got looked weird. It was tiny pieces of chicken that looked almost like pieces of ground turkey and it didn't taste like chicken. The tacos smelled like catfood. I almost couldn't make myself eat them, and I did only eat one and a half of the 4. The rice and beans were really good. I'm glad. That's the only way I was able to eat the tacos. We ordered sliced avocado to the side and the pieces were so hard and tasteless. The avocado wasn't ripe. The waitress brought us some more, which was the right texture. She was a nice woman. Overall, I had a bad experience and I'm still feeling bad remembering the smell of the food, and the bad taste. I stopped by a gas station and got some candy to try to get the taste out of my mouth. I would not recommend this restaurant.
I ordered the Beef Birria Tacos with a side beans and rice. Chips and Salsa come complementary. The drink I believe was a Peach Margarita. I've never had Birria Tacos and decided to give them a try. They were very tasty, flavorful and a nice meat to shell ratio. The beans and rice were yum, yum, yum ????. The Margaritas was very refreshing. I will be back to try my favorite food Taquitos/Flautas.
